Version: Windchill 12.0
Use Case: I have a large document open in Arbortext from our Windchill area, and when I run "Export as Compound Document", I see all the Windchill objects appearing in my local folder, with the DD# added to the filenames. I"m using Arbortext 8.2.1.0 and Windchill 12.0.7.
Description:
The issue is that inside the files, any references to other objects are still referring to the windchill path (x-wc://file=dd00118571.xml for example). Looking at the help article here: https://support.ptc.com/help/arbortext/r8.2.1.0/en/index.html#page/editor/editor_help/help17084.html
It seems like the references to Windchill objects should now be updated to point to the local files in the folder being used for the export and not the windchill path URL. Something I also just noticed is some files are being modified after the initial export, is this a post-processing step to update the references that I just have to let run until finished? Thank you!
